To leave or not to leave

With Hurricane Gustav almost in the Gulf of Mexico the question is..."To leave or not to leave?" Yesterday afternoon after I got home from work Peter and I discussed whether or not we should leave. What we did decide was to make reservations at a hotel and then we would go from there. We wanted at least some kind of back up plan. We called hotels all up IH-45 just before Dallas and not a hotel room could be found. So we started calling around San Antonio and found a room in Sequin and booked it but we had to cancel by 3:00 pm today if we decided not to go. I am sorry but we probably won't know if we should leave at least until Sunday morning or afternoon. So I called and canceled our reservations. During the time of calling hotels yesterday, my mom and I were on the phone and were trying to decide what to do. I have an aunt that lives in Denison which is about 6 hours away. I am in no mood to drive 6 hours or more depending on traffic and then turn around the next day and drive home because we were spared from Gustav. Guess what??? I forgot I have a cousin that lives in Austin. My aunt (her mother) lives in Baton Rouge and have left already and are heading to Austin. When my aunt talked to my cousin she said that we were all welcomed. So I have called her and left a message and praying she calls me back today. My mom and dad are coming to my house tonight so they can be at least and hour and a half closer to Austin and if we are spared then the drive won't be so bad. Do I think Gustav is going to hit us? No. The hurricane models continue to show it moving into Louisiana and that hasn't changed in 24 hours so no I don't think it will hit us. Am I going to be prepared to leave just in case??? Yes I am.

Fun at the mall!



Today we met Sherri, Zoe and Ruth (Sherri and Will's exchange student from Hong Kong) at Memorial City Mall. Olivia got to ride the carousel five times and loved every minute of it. We went down to the Picture People to have Olivia's picture taken. We haven't had her portrait done since the Easter before last so I felt like it was time. Our appointment was
at 11:20 and we got there around 11:10 so of course we had to wait a little while. It was just me and Ruth with Olivia and Zoe. Sherri had gone down to have her eyebrows threaded. Instead of waxing they use regular thread to shape and trim your eyebrows. It is amazing. I had it done after Olivia's picture was taken. I must admit it did hurt a little. It was a different pain than having my eyebrows waxed.
Anyway while we were waiting at the Picture People, Olivia and Zoe entertained themselves by twirling around and around on the chairs. They both were really good but they were everywhere and instead of walking they ran. We went to lunch at Chik fil A and they both got a bookmark with a magnifying lense so instead of using it as a bookmark they tore the bottom off and just used the
magnifying lense. It was so funny. They would stop and get on the ground with their lense and pretend they were looking for clues. I wish I would have taken of picture of them doing that. Well after lunch and getting my eyebrows done we went back to view Olivia's pictures and buy them. I love Picture People because you get the pictures the same day. After getting everything done we
decided to go home. We had been at the mall since 10:30 and it was around 1:45 by the time we left. We weren't in the car five minutes and Olivia was out. She was a tired little girl.
